The President, Nana Addo Dankwa Akufo-Addo has extended his condolences to the people of Burundi following the death of President Pierre Nkurunziza.

In a tweet on Wednesday, June 10, President Akufo-Addo also extended his condolences to the government of the Republic of Burundi.

“The Ghanaian people and I extend our deepest condolences to the Government and people of the Republic of Burundi, on the sad news of the death of their President, His Excellency Pierre Nkurunziza.”

“May his soul rest in perfect peace,” he added.

Burundian President Pierre Nkurunziza, aged 55, died after suffering what the government said was a heart attack.

The central African nation says Nkurunziza died at the Karusi Hospital in eastern Burundi late on Monday, two days after he reported feeling unwell and was taken to the facility.
